Q: Is 1,259,307 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,259,307 is a composite number.

Why is 1,259,307 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,259,307 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 21 27 63 81 189 567 2,221 6,663 15,547 19,989 46,641 59,967 139,923 179,901 419,769 and 1,259,307, with no remainder.

Since 1,259,307 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,259,307, it is a composite number.
